Murder Suspect Was on Probation For Home Burglary

Romero was Charged with Stealing from Schulenburg Home in September 2022 The suspect accused of murdering an Edna teen and arrested in Schulenburg last Saturday was on probation for a home burglary that occurred here in 2022. Rafael Govea Romero, 23 of Schulenburg, faces a capital murder charge for allegedly killing 16-year-old Lizbeth Medina, a high school cheerleader from Edna.

Lady Leps Go 2-2 at Brazos Tourney

The La Grange girls basketball team went 2-2 at the Brazos Tournament over the weekend and were named tourney runner-ups. The Lady Leps now have a 8-5 overall record.

Flatonia Girls Win Their Home Tournament Title

The Flatonia girls basketball team won their second consecutive tournament title as they claimed the championship of their home tournament last week. That comes on the heels of their Fayetteville tournament title the week before.
